IKEJA, Lagos, Nigeria – Justice Rahman Oshodi of the Ikeja Domestic Violence and Sexual Offences Court has ordered the remand of Onyeka Mbaka in the Kirikiri Maximum Correctional Centre for alleged defilement of a 15-year-old girl.
Mbaka will remain in custody until March 22, 2024 as directed by Justice Oshodi.
The defendant, whose residential address was not disclosed, faced charges of defilement brought by the Lagos State Government.
Despite pleading not guilty, the state counsel, Ms. Bukola Okeowo, requested the court to remand the defendant accordingly.
Okeowo informed the court that the prosecution planned to present three witnesses to substantiate the charges against Mbaka.
The alleged offense took place in March 2023 at No. 16, Moshalasi Street, Ilasa area of Lagos, contravening Section 137 of the Criminal Laws of Lagos State 2015.
